The harpoon dates from the mesolithic period. This was within that last, the most recent period of exposure. The tools are very important because they tell us about the incredible time depth that's associated with these submerged landscape. So we know that these landscapes ware exposed repeatedly throughout that past million years. Ar, these actually stretch back the entire time we've had people living in britain and north west europe - which at the moment is about a million years ago.
